Alcoholism: Is There Any Option Other Than Total Abstinence?

Woman in prayer Even though the 12 steps propagate that alcoholism is a progressive disease with an inevitably harmful outcome, data from the National Epidemiological Survey on Alcohol and Related Conditions illustrates that almost one-fifth of the alcohol dependent participants continued to drink at low-risk levels with no symptoms of abuse.
